#928101 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#928101 is composed of 57.3% red, 50.6%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.6% magenta, 99.3%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 53 degrees, a saturation of 98.6% and a lightness of 28.8%. #928101 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ff02 with #250300.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

#928101 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#928101 has RGB values of R:146, G:129,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.99,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 9601281.
